If the user changes the colors for covariates in the GUI Builder the colors on the legends should be the user selected colors on the expanded pdf and should be included. Continuous legends don't seem to even display colors.
Colors in breaks on expanded map legends and breakpoints do not seem to match breakpoints selected in map.

I cannot reproduce what I thought this issue was: covariate colors changed in the builder's covariates page did not affect the covariate colors used in the expanded PDF. I could not reproduce that. Everything appears to work as expected.
Another possible interpretation is that changing covariate colors in the viewer's display properties dialog doesn't affect the colors in the expanded PDF. This is certainly true, but long standing behavior. No changes made in the viewer affect the builder's map properties. We can consider changing this behavior (it is probably hard) but it's not a show-stopper.
You also mention continuous covariate legends not displaying colors at all. I could not reproduce that behavior.
Another issue is that the breaks (and hence colors of those breaks) in the PDF are not the same as those chosen by the user. This is also long-standing behavior both here and in the viewer. We can discuss but it's not a show-stopper.
